建立Podspec 並且發布到github spec,podspecgithub

來源:互聯網
上載者:User

建立Podspec 並且發布到github spec,podspecgithub

昨天,花了點時間,把自己的代碼做成framework,但是發現,每次遷移項目或者更新項目都是一件很頭疼的事情,索性,也跟著時尚了一回,把所有代碼都扔到git裡面進行管理,通過cococapods直接安裝即可,下面是已經建立完.podspec檔案後,需要做的步驟:

1.本地測試是否正常

pod lib lint --allow-warnings

2.git 上傳至 oschina或者github 後,標記當前源碼版本號碼,不然發布會報錯

git tag '1.0.1'git push --tags

3.設定本地pod對應的版本號碼

set the new version to 1.0.1set the new tag to 1.0.1

4.必須註冊cocoapods的帳號,只需要帳號,註冊成功返回一個token,但是前提你得先到郵箱驗證一下cococapods發給你的驗證碼,證明當前郵箱確實是你的(注意:token是有時效性的,如果到期了,得重複這個步驟)

pod trunk register xxxxx@qq.com 'author name' --description='macbook pro' --verbose

5.準備步驟全部搞定了,下面就是上傳你自己的podspec檔案到官方的倉儲了

pod trunk push xxxx.podspec --allow-warnings

到此,你的podspec檔案,已經發布完成,可以通過pod search 去查詢自己的項目是否上傳成功!!!!

相關文章

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.